Ferguson home values have plummeted almost 50 percent since Michael Brown’s death

Monday, March 16th, 2015

Ferguson home values have plummeted almost 50 percent since Michael Brown’s death.

From the article:

The average selling price of a home in the city has been on a steady decline since the shooting of Brown last August, according to housing data compiled from MARIS, an information and statistics service for real estate agents. Prior to Brown’s death, the average home sold in 2014 was selling for $66,764. For the last three and a half months of the year, the average home sold for $36,168, a 46 percent decrease.
